Airport Flyer Express Link

Departing every 10 minutes*

Airport Express

The Airport Flyer Express Link is the only bus service linking Bristol Temple Meads railway station, Bristol bus station, Clifton and Bristol Airport.

Route

From Bristol Airport, the service operates two alternating routes, the A1 linking Bedminster, Temple Meads and the bus station and the A2 service which serves the city centre and key hotels as well as Temple Meads and the bus station.

Journey time and frequency

The journey time to the city centre is approximately 30 minutes, with services operating 24 hours a day, 7 days a week*. At peak times, buses depart up to every 10 minutes from key locations including Bristol Airport, Temple Meads and Bristol Bus Station.

* Please refer to timetable for the first service departing daily at each individual stop.

Clifton connections

Clifton destinations can be reached from the Clifton Triangle or College Green stops by connecting with local First Bus service numbers 1, 54, 54a, 40, 40a and the 8 and 9 services.

For customers requiring travel from Clifton to Bristol Airport, please view the A2 timetable (to Bristol). Customers can board the Flyer at any of the A2 stops for onward transport to Bristol Airport. The A2 service will stop at the bus station en route to Bristol Airport. The service number will change to A1 when leaving the bus station. There is no need to change buses.

  • Service operates every day except Christmas Day (limited services on Boxing Day and New Years Day).
  • One month validity on all return tickets purchased.
  • All England Concessionary Travelcards accepted.
  • Local area Student Photo ID Cards accepted (UWE, Bristol, Bath and Bath Spa).
  • Family return ticket discount applies to two Adults and two Children (under 16 years of age).
  • Child fare applies to any person aged five to 15 years of age inclusive.
  • Accompanied infants aged 0 to four years of age inclusive travel free of charge.

Train and coach connections

The Airport Flyer Express Link allows easy connections to a vast rail network accessible from Temple Meads railway station, which is served at 10 minute intervals during peak times. From Temple Meads there are frequent train services to Bath, the West Country and further locations such as London and South Wales.  More >>

Train tickets to most UK railway stations as well as the Airport Flyer Express Link can be purchased from the rail ticket machine located within the arrivals concourse at Bristol Airport.

Local bus and National Express coach connections are also available from Marlborough Street bus station.  More >>

How to book

  • Book online.
  • Pay the driver as you board.
  • Book combined Train/Flyer tickets at www.thetrainline.com or collect tickets from your local train station for all connecting journeys via Temple Meads.
  • Book combined National Express/Flyer tickets at www.nationalexpress.com for all connecting coach journeys via Bristol bus station.
  • Buy a Through Ticket on any First Bristol/First Somerset & Avon bus to the City Centre for all local bus connections via Bristol bus station.

Please note: All National Express coach through tickets need to be collected prior to your date of travel, as there is currently no facility at Bristol Airport. Rail tickets can be collected from the Fast ticket machine located in the arrivals concourse at the Airport.

The Airport Express does not operate on Christmas Day and a limited timetable applies on Boxing Day and New Years Day.
